COLUMBUS, Ohio (WSYX) –Meet this year's winner of the Cadbury Bunny contest, Annie Rose the English Doodle from Cincinnati. Ohio.

She is a therapy dog who loves bringing smiles to everyone. As a therapy dog, she visits nursing homes throughout the Buckeye state.

When COVID-19 restrictions were in effect and nursing homes weren't accepting visitors, Annie Rose didn't give up. She still showed up at nursing homes and greeted everyone outside the windows instead.

"We can't thank everyone enough for voting for our very own Annie Rose and making her the next Cadbury Bunny, especially her doodle families and friends who went over and beyond," said Lori R., Annie Rose's owner. "Our community rallied behind and supported her just as she has for them for years as a therapy dog. All of us are still shocked by the news but can't wait to get Annie Rose those iconic Cadbury Bunny ears."

Her votes helped raise money for The American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als.

She is the second Ohio winner, following New Richmond's Lt. Dan who won in 2020.

Annie Rose will also take home $5,000.
